GugalagaPDF

The platform allows parents to find and compare kindergartens in the city of Zagreb. Users see a map where they can search for kindergartens in specific locations, kindergarten programs, or other themes. If a user clicks on a kindergarten, the contact details and a link to the public website of the kindergarten appears. Also, the tool allows people to rate a kindergarten and its services.

Five years of RescEU: Strengthening Europe's response to disasters

Five years of RescEU: Strengthening Europe's response to disasters

This year marks the fifth anniversary of RescEU, an initiative by the European Commission that has strengthened disaster response mechanisms across Europe. Established to extend the EU Civil Protection Mechanism, RescEU embodies a deep commitment to protecting citizens from diverse disasters and managing emerging risks effectively. Since its launch in 2019, RescEU has served as a robust reserve of European capacities, fully funded by the EU.
